## Deployment

Farethrum, our shipping-fee rules engine, deploys via the standard Coppergate pipeline. Merge to main triggers staging; production requires one approval. Rules hot-reload, so most fee changes need no redeploy. Before your first deploy, confirm your access with the platform team. The service boots with the following configuration.

settings of yageg-yahap:
[gorael]
team = olieth
access_code = ac_941d74
owner = brieth.aldiel
host = gorael.tolvaqio.internal
port = 6379
peer = briwyn.urlaqtech.internal
salt = 116e6622
pin = 1957

Q2 Planning Note — Board Circulation

The Brindlemark pilot with retail chain Tollevar is live in six stores across the Harwick region. Early data: basket conversion up 4%, shrinkage flat. Rollout decision expected within eight weeks. Costs tracking to plan; one integration issue resolved. Tollevar leadership remains engaged. Next board update will include full pilot metrics and the expansion proposal. The confidential commercial outlook is set out immediately below.

management briefing: Ralysox Holdings is in early talks to buy Belaxox Logistics for about $377.3 million. The Jorox launch date is January 10, and nothing goes to the press before then. Legal wants the Belaelek Foods term sheet countersigned before March 5.

Guest Wi-Fi at Bramwell Tower is handled from the reception desk in the main lobby. Team assistants should direct visitors to the Verano Guest network and issue the daily passphrase printed on the laminated card in the top drawer. To restock cards or reset the portal, assistants need access to the comms cupboard behind reception, which requires the pass below.

door code, tagef-bajop: bdg-SB-7